使用Postgrest快速创建数据库的OpenAPI接口
生活随笔
收集整理的這篇文章主要介紹了
使用Postgrest快速创建数据库的OpenAPI接口
小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
?
下載鏡像
?
正確運(yùn)行需要修改postgrest配置文件。可以修改鏡像中的配置文件/etc/postgrest.conf,或者修改運(yùn)行的環(huán)境變量(具有“?PGRST_?”前綴)。使用下面命令可以查看系統(tǒng)的環(huán)境變量:
?
最簡(jiǎn)單的postgrest配置文件如下
# 連接URI db-uri = "postgres://user:password@192.168.126.131:5432/database" # database schema to expose to REST clients db-schema = "public" # 如果客戶端沒(méi)有認(rèn)證,使用的數(shù)據(jù)庫(kù)角色 db-anon-role = "user"運(yùn)行docker
docker run --rm -p 3000:3000 \-e PGRST_DB_URI="postgres://user:password@192.168.126.131/database" \-e PGRST_DB_ANON_ROLE="user" \-e PGRST_DB_SCHEMA="public" \postgrest/postgrest訪問(wèn) http://ip:3000即可看到結(jié)果。
為了方便測(cè)試,安裝一個(gè)swagger。
?
總結(jié)
以上是生活随笔為你收集整理的使用Postgrest快速创建数据库的OpenAPI接口的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: Rest标准
- 下一篇: Matlab处理JSON数据